What I Would Check Before Buying
Before buying, I would make sure the robot fits my home layout and cleaning needs. I would check:
- My floor type: hardwood, tile, carpet, or mixed surfaces
- Whether I have pets and deal with hair regularly
- How much maintenance I am willing to do
- Whether the dock has enough space in my home
- How important mopping is in my routine
